When defining a new DNS server, the following additional parameters are available:
Supported IP Format — Specifies the IP format supported by the server. The possible values are:
IPv6 — IP version 6 is supported.
IPv4 — IP version 4 is supported.
IPv6 Address Type — When the server supports IPv6 (see previous parameter), this specifies the type
of static address supported. The possible values are:
Link Local — A Link Local address that is non-routable and used for communication on the same
network only.
Global — A globally unique IPv6 address; visible and reachable from different subnets.
Link Local Interface — When the server supports an IPv6 Link Local address (see previous
parameter), this specifies the the Link Local interface. The possible values are:
VLAN1 — The IPv6 interface is configured on VLAN1.
ISATAP — The IPv6 interface is configured on ISATAP tunnel.
Adding a DNS Server
1 Open the Domain Naming System (DNS) page.
2 Click Add.
The Add DNS Server page opens.
Figure 6-44. Add DNS Server
In addition to the fields in the Domain Naming System (DNS) page, the Add DNS Server page
contains the following field:
DNS Server — DNS Server IP address.
3 Define the relevant fields.
4 Click Apply Changes.
The new DNS server is defined, and the device is updated.
